Dorking (Deepdene) Station: Facilities and Accessibility

Dorking (Deepdene) train station is well-equipped with essential facilities to make your journey smooth. Although there's no ticket office, travelers can use the available ticket machines for collection—a necessity for those purchasing rail tickets online. It’s worth mentioning the presence of accessible ticket machines, ensuring that everyone can acquire their tickets with ease. For those needing assistance, a help point is available, providing information and support. However, it’s important to note that, there is no staff service on-site to personally assist travelers.

The station does not offer any refreshment facilities, ATMs, or cycle hire services, so it might be a good idea to plan ahead for your refreshment and cash needs. There is a bicycle storage solution on site with 56 spaces, sheltered to protect your bike from the weather elements. Stay reassured with the CCTV camera keeping an eye on their safety.

Everything you need to know about Herne Bay Station

Welcome to Herne Bay Train Station

Herne Bay Train Station, nestled in the picturesque coastal town of the same name, serves as a vital link for both daily commuters and those venturing out on leisure trips. Known for its charming seaside environment, Herne Bay offers more than just beautiful views and serene beaches; it is also a gateway to a network of travel possibilities perfect for exploring the rest of Kent and beyond.

When planning your journey, the station offers convenient ticket purchasing options to streamline your travel experience. The ticket office opens from 6:10 AM to 7:00 PM on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 9:10 AM to 4:00 PM on Sundays. With ticket machines readily available and located on Platform 2, collecting tickets purchased online couldn't be easier. Smartcard technology is also supported at this station, although smartcard validators are not present, ensuring you're prepared for both contemporary and traditional ticketing methods.

Station Amenities and Services

Herne Bay Train Station ensures passengers receive quality support and amenities throughout their visit. Help points are installed for assistance, accompanied by comprehensive departure screens and announcements. Operating hours for staff help closely match ticket office hours, ensuring personal assistance when necessary. Although the station lacks luggage storage, lost property can be managed through Southeastern Customer Services.

Accessible facilities are notably present to assist passengers with mobility constraints. Step-free access is available to Platform 2, while Platform 1 has step access only. A range of supportive facilities, such as accessible ticket machines, induction loops, and ramps for train access, contribute to an inclusive travel environment. For a touch of comfort, seating areas are provided, though waiting rooms are absent, making outside seating the principal option for relaxation during your wait.
